Many studies have shown that air pollutants have complex impacts on urban precipitation.Meteorological weather station and satellite Aerosol Optical Depth (AOD) product data from the last 20 years, combined with simulation results from the Weather Research and Forecasting model coupled with Chemistry (WRF-Chem), this paper focuses on the effects of dea eyewear air pollutants on summer precipitation in different regions of Beijing.These results showed that air pollution intensity during the summer affected the precipitation contribution rate (PCR) of plains and mountainous regions in the Beijing area, especially in the plains.

Over the past 20 years, plains PCR increased by ~10% when the AOD augmented by 0.15, whereas it decreased with lower pollution levels.In contrast, PCR in mountainous areas decreased with higher pollution levels and increased with lower pollution levels.

Our analysis from model results indicated that aerosol increases reduce merrick backcountry wet cat food the effective particle size of cloud droplets and raindrops.Smaller cloud raindrops more readily transport to high air layers and participate in the generation of ice-phase substances in the clouds, increasing the total amount of cloud water in the air in a certain time, which ultimately enhanced precipitation intensity on the plains.The removal of pollutants caused by increased precipitation in the plains decreased rainfall levels in mountainous areas.
